Der Einflu� von Nebennierenrindenhormonen auf die Vasopressin-Wirkung bei Wasserdiurese intakter Ratten
1959
The influence of 3 day courses of various corticosteroids on the antidiuretic and saluretic activity of vasopressin (1, 10 or 100 mU per rat s. c.) in hydrated, normal, unanesthetized rats was investigated. The corticosteroids tested were Cortisone acetate (25 mg/kg · day s. c.), Cortexone acetate (20 mg/kg · day s. c.), Cortisol acetate (25 mg/kg · day s. c.) and d.l-Aldosterone acetate (0,5 mg/kg · day s. c.).
Towards the tailoring of glucocorticoid replacement in adrenal insufficiency: the Italian Society of Endocrinology Expert Opinion.
2020
Context: Glucocorticoid (GC) replacement therapy in patients with adrenal insufficiency (AI) is life saving. After over 50 years of conventional GC treatment, novel formulations are now entering routine clinical practice. Methods: Given the spectrum of medications currently available and new insights into the understanding of AI, the authors reviewed relevant medical literature with emphasis on original studies, prospective observational data and randomized controlled trials performed in the past 35 years.
